Services Offered:
----------------
The AMPTE/CCE SDC archives the entire AMPTE/CCE mission data set of Level 1
(i.e., Raw Geophysical Parameter) and ancillary data and provides analysis and
display utilities for viewing into these data set.
   Data sets accessible from the facility:
     AMPTE/CCE Mission ( 1984/DOY 229  through  1989/DOY 10)
       Full measurement (Level 1) data
         Charge-Energy-Mass (CHEM) spectrometer
         Hot-Plasma Composition Experiment (HPCE)
         Medium-Energy Particle Analyzer (MEPA) Instrument
         Magnetometer (MAG) instrument
         Plasma Wave (PWE) instrument
       Averaged (Level 1) data
         CHEM - 6.4 min ave
         HPCE - 6.4 min ave
         MEPA - 6.4 min ave
         MAG  -  68 sec ave
         PWE  -  62 sec ave
     GOES 5,6 and 7 Missions ( 1984/DOY 214  through  1988/DOY 279)
       Averaged data
  Analysis Utilities
    CHEM
      Calculate the flux or distribution function of major ion species
         for all 32 energy step using either rate or PHA data
    HPCE
      Compute energy spectra, pitch angle distributions, distribution
         functions, radial profiles, time series and other standard space
         plasma parameters
    MEPA
      Reading specific data items from the data files
      Fitting a sin(theta) to the power n dependence to the observed
         anisotropy
      Computing pressure or electrical currents
      Calculate the flux or distribution function of major ion species
    MAG
      Despin and rotate to space-fixed coordinates the highest resolution
         (8 samples/sec) mag data
    CCE Science Data Center
      Scan catalog of off-line data archive for desired data
      Request promotion of off-line data file to on-line storage
      Retrieve attitude and Keplar orbit elements information
      Convert among coordinate systems
  Display utilities
    CHEM
      Stacked line plots of flux of major ion against time
      Flux vs. pitch angle
      Pulse height data as detected mass against detected mass per charge
    HPCE
      Line plots, color spectrograms, and surface contours of above listed
         HPCE analysis results
    MEPA
      Time or radial profiles of ion fluxes
      PHA data, particle spectra or pitch angle anisotropies
    MAG
      Time vs. BX, BY, BZ, ~B~ in desired coordinate frame
    PWE
      Time vs. high resolution data
    CCE Science Data Center
      Spacecraft orbit trajectory in several coordinate systems
